Was the end of ancient greek civilization connected to the rise of rome by the middle ages?

Yes, the end of ancient Greek civilization was closely connected to the rise of Rome, as Rome gradually conquered Greek city-states and incorporated their culture, language, and governance into its own. By the time of the Middle Ages, the fall of the Western Roman Empire in 476 AD marked a significant shift, leading to the decline of urban centers and the fragmentation of territories that had been influenced by Greek and Roman traditions. However, the Eastern Roman Empire, or Byzantine Empire, preserved much of Greek heritage until its fall in 1453, bridging the ancient and medieval worlds.


Did the ottoman empire end the Roman empire?

The Ottoman Empire did not directly end the Roman Empire, as the Western Roman Empire had already fallen in 476 AD, long before the rise of the Ottomans. The Eastern Roman Empire, or Byzantine Empire, continued until the Ottomans captured Constantinople in 1453. This conquest marked the end of the Byzantine Empire and solidified the Ottoman Empire's dominance in the region. Thus, while the Ottomans played a significant role in the fall of the Byzantine Empire, they did not end the Roman Empire in its entirety.
